This beer has fresh raspberry puree added which is sourced and grown locally, less than 10 miles from the brewery. It has a very simple malt profile and only one hop variety present (Huel Melon) which allows the raspberry flavour and aroma to shine through. This beer contains between 10% and 11% raspberry content on average and is a seasonal, light summer beer. This beer screams fresh summer sunny days.

Hops: Huell Mellon
Mals: Malted Barley & Maris Otter
Other additios: Raspberries & Lactose
